Q
What assets are protected in bankruptcy?

Ask a Domestic Violence lawyer in Woree

Protected assets typically include household goods, tools of trade, and a limited amount of equity in your home.;Certain personal items and a vehicle with limited value may also be protected from seizure.

Q
What is the significance of a written contract?

Ask a Domestic Violence lawyer in Woree

A written contract provides clear evidence of the terms agreed upon and can help prevent misunderstandings.;It is also easier to enforce a written contract in court compared to a verbal agreement.
